With its famously green landscape and unpredictable weather patterns, Ireland can be a really challenging environment for gardening and maintaining lush lawns. This is because the country’s frequent rain showers, interspersed with occasional dry spells, usually make keeping a pristine natural lawn a bit difficult.
This is where synthetic grass comes in. It is a modern landscaping solution suitable for the Irish climate. From drainage capabilities to durability and low maintenance, artificial turf offers benefits tailored specifically for Ireland’s unique conditions.

Drainage Capabilities
Any Irish gardener can attest that rain is a common occurrence in the country, and saturated lawns are a familiar result. Because of the environment, natural grass can easily become waterlogged after heavy showers. However, artificial turf, on the other hand, is designed to allow efficient drainage. Rainwater quickly filters through the synthetic blades into the porous backing and drainage system below. This leaves the surface dry and walkable, without large puddles. For homeowners that are tired of soggy areas after storms, artificial lawns are great idea.
Durability Through Seasons
While natural grass morphs throughout the year based on changing weather, artificial turf retains its vibrant green appearance no matter the season. It won’t turn to a muddy mess during the rainy periods, nor dry out and discolor during brief dry spells. The consistency of synthetic grass means you can enjoy a verdant lawn in spring, summer, autumn and winter without seasonal ups and downs.
Minimal Upkeep
A major advantage of artificial turf is the minimal required maintenance compared to natural lawns. There’s no need for regular mowing, watering, fertilizing, aerating or reseeding bald spots. You can say goodbye to rushing out to mow the grass after a stretch of rain. Artificial lawns allow you to enjoy picture-perfect curb appeal and usability without labor-intensive upkeep. Just an occasional light brushing and rinse is all it takes.

Erosion Prevention
In parts of Ireland prone to soil erosion from heavy rain and winds, synthetic grass can provide protective ground cover. Unlike natural grass, the synthetic turf forms a stable barrier that prevents the displacement of soil, rocks and other materials. This provides not only aesthetic but also functional benefits, reducing unsafe pits, ruts and other hazards that can come with erosion. The stability of artificial lawns makes them ideal for locations vulnerable to weather-related erosion.
